This scholarly work chronicles the intricate history of Leonardo da Vinci's invaluable manuscripts. It meticulously details the provenance and evolution of these seminal documents, offering profound insights into the Renaissance master's intellectual pursuits. The volume further presents a comprehensive examination of the various manuscript editions available in facsimile, providing critical context for their study. Readers will gain an authoritative understanding of the preservation and dissemination of Da Vinci's scientific, artistic, and engineering notations. This essential reference illustrates the enduring legacy of one of history's greatest minds through his original writings.
